package com.cappielloantonio.tempo.glide; import androidx.annotation.NonNull; import com.bumptech.glide.Priority; import com.bumptech.glide.load.DataSource; import com.bumptech.glide.load.Options; import com.bumptech.glide.load.data.DataFetcher; import com.bumptech.glide.load.model.ModelLoader; import com.bumptech.glide.load.model.ModelLoaderFactory; import com.bumptech.glide.load.model.MultiModelLoaderFactory; import com.bumptech.glide.signature.ObjectKey; import java.io.IOException; import java.io.InputStream; import java.net.HttpURLConnection; import java.net.URL; public class IPv6StringLoader implements ModelLoader { private static final int DEFAULT_TIMEOUT_MS = 2500; @Override public boolean handles(@NonNull String model) { return model.startsWith("http://") || model.startsWith("https://"); } @Override public LoadData buildLoadData(@NonNull String model, int width, int height, @NonNull Options options) { if (!handles(model)) { return null; } return new LoadData<>(new ObjectKey(model), new IPv6StreamFetcher(model)); } private static class IPv6StreamFetcher implements DataFetcher { private final String model; private InputStream stream; private HttpURLConnection connection; IPv6StreamFetcher(String model) { this.model = model; } @Override public void loadData(@NonNull Priority priority, @NonNull DataCallback callback) { try { URL url = new URL(model); connection = (HttpURLConnection) url.openConnection(); connection.setConnectTimeout(DEFAULT_TIMEOUT_MS); connection.setReadTimeout(DEFAULT_TIMEOUT_MS); connection.setUseCaches(true); connection.setDoInput(true); connection.connect(); if (connection.getResponseCode() / 100 != 2) { callback.onLoadFailed(new IOException("Request failed with status code: " + connection.getResponseCode())); return; } stream = connection.getInputStream(); callback.onDataReady(stream); } catch (IOException e) { callback.onLoadFailed(e); } } @Override public void cleanup() { if (stream != null) { try { stream.close(); } catch (IOException ignored) { } } if (connection != null) { connection.disconnect(); } } @Override public void cancel() { // HttpURLConnection does not provide a direct cancel mechanism. } @NonNull @Override public Class getDataClass() { return InputStream.class; } @NonNull @Override public DataSource getDataSource() { return DataSource.REMOTE; } } public static class Factory implements ModelLoaderFactory { @NonNull @Override public ModelLoader build(@NonNull MultiModelLoaderFactory multiFactory) { return new IPv6StringLoader(); } @Override public void teardown() { // No-op } } }
